Open Access And Principles Of ORCID

Hurix Digital

Open access (OA) refers to the free online availability of articles and publications and other digital information with limited restrictions on the reuse of the same. OA started in 2000 and is a relatively new publication model in the history of scientific journals. . This is especially important for authors and readers.
